How our Access Control Installation works in El Cerrito
We keep access control installation simple for El Cerrito customers. A typical job follows these steps:
Assess doors: We review doors, power, and traffic flow.
Design the system: We plan readers, locks, and credentials.
Install: We mount hardware and wire the system.
Set up access: We configure credentials and train your team.
